i was out in my back yard and i was moving stuff around and i found a  bunch of garden worms. i was wondering if they will work for ice fishing and what do you catch on them do you jig??? or put on a tip up??? any info would be great
I always use a small piece of night crawler on all my jiggs Ive caught bass pics perch crappie sunnys trout and hornpout when the fish stop hittin your jig that ussualy means they stole your worm keep them in the frige if the soil drys up put a little water on them keeps them from dying and stinking  hope this helps ive been scolded many times for stinky worms in the frige :-[
